【python】求水仙数

for i in range(100, 1000):
sum = 0
temp = i
while temp:
sum = sum + (temp%10) ** 3
temp //= 10 # 注意使用地板除哦~
if sum == i:
print(i)

 

来源:小甲鱼习题

posted @ 2016-10-31 13:43  GiraffaMPRO  阅读(195)  评论(0编辑  收藏  举报